BOOK XVIII

And now there arrived a public beggar, who used to go begging through

the town of Ithaka, known to fame for his ravenous belly and appetite for

eating and drinking. There was no real strength in him, nor any force, but

his build was big to look at.

5 He had the name Arnaios, for thus the lady his mother called him from birth,

but all the young men used to call him Iros, because he would run and

give messages when anyone told him.
